>> Just for google completeness
>
>>       (goto-char (org-entry-beginning-position)) (set-mark
>> (org-entry-end-position))
>
>> seemed the most efficient after digging about a bit.
>
> As a side note,
>
> (goto-char (org-entry-beginning-position))
>
> is in fact a convoluted way (if you don't need point value) of calling
>
> (outline-back-to-heading t)
>
> so I doubt this is the "most efficient" in this case.
>

Good spot - but I will probably stick to the org- functions in general
in case they are ever expanded for whatever reasons.

The speed overhead in an interactive environment is pretty much zero ;)
